A shady spot under apple trees, birches and poplars, on the edge of a small wetland biotope in an idyllic location with a view of the Borner post mill - peace and quiet in the Hoher Fläming nature reserve.
The meadow with the pitches is on the edge of the village behind our beautiful three-sided farm and is bordered on the south side by the Berlin-Dessau railway line. The regional train passes by twice an hour and is not extremely loud, freight train traffic is very irregular and can sometimes be loud. The small pond, on the edge of which the pitches are, hardly has any water in the very dry summers of recent times. The area offers shade and places to chill out. A vegetable field, two greenhouses and our own chickens enable partial self-sufficiency. Seasonally, guests can share in the fresh produce. The village is small and has an idyllic old farm church and a real post mill, which is also open on some Sundays and can be visited inside. The place is generally very quiet.
The Activities
There are horse riding opportunities right here in the village, and every two weeks on Saturdays there is a bar where you can bring and take things away for a small donation. On some Sundays the old restored post mill is open. Many hiking trails cross the village. The art hiking trail also leads directly through Borne and you can start beautiful circular hikes from here. The European cycle route E1 passes the neighboring town, which is 2 km away, so the area can also be explored in several directions by bike. Eisenhardt Castle in Bad Belzig with its delightful little "Chocolateria" and regular exhibitions by the art association and Rabenstein Castle with various events are worth a visit. Excellent live concerts are regularly held in "Mals Scheune" in the neighboring town of Wiesenburg. You can find out about alternative lifestyles at ZEGG in Bad Belzig.
Other things
Bad Belzig with its train station, shops, pharmacies, hospital, cinema and swimming pool is 5 km away and easy to reach by bike. The RE7 runs every hour from Bad Belzig through the whole of Berlin (Zoo, main station, Alexanderplatz) and directly to BER. It takes an hour to get to the city center, so it's easy to do for day trips.
